Position Overview: As a Senior Salesforce Developer, you will be responsible for leading the technical aspects of Salesforce projects, collaborating closely with cross-functional teams including sales, success and support ops leaders and analysts. Your expertise in Salesforce development, configuration, customization, integration, and best practices will be critical in ensuring the success of our Salesforce initiatives. You will also mentor and guide junior developers, fostering a culture of continuous learning and improvement. Responsibilities: As a senior member of the Salesforce development team, you will lead the project development from requirements to deployment on Salesforce and salesforce related tools. Lead the design, development, testing, and deployment of Salesforce solutions using Apex, Visualforce, Lightning components, and other related technologies. Collaborate with business analysts and st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into technical solutions that align with business goals. Customize and configure Salesforce to address complex business processes and requirements. Perform data migrations and integrations between Salesforce and other systems using APIs, middleware, and ETL tools. Architect and implement solutions that follow best practices in security, scalability, and maintainability. Provide technical leadership and guidance to junior developers, conducting code reviews and ensuring high-quality code standards are maintained. Troubleshoot and resolve issues related to Salesforce applications, integrations, and customizations. Stay up-to-date with the latest Salesforce features, releases, and industry trends to propose innovative solutions. Collaborate with the QA team to ensure thorough testing of applications and resolve any defects. Participate in the evaluation and selection of new tools, technologies, and processes to enhance the development and deployment process. Contribute to the development and maintenance of documentation related to architecture, design, and technical processes. Qualifications: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field (or equivalent experience). Minimum of 5 years of hands-on experience in Salesforce development. Salesforce Platform Developer certification is required; additional certifications such as Application Architect or System Architect are a plus. Proficiency in Apex, Visualforce, Lightning Components, and other Salesforce development technologies. Strong understanding of Salesforce integration patterns, REST and SOAP APIs, and data migration techniques. Experience with version control systems and continuous integration/continuous deployment (CI/CD) processes. Solid understanding of software development best practices and design patterns.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to troubleshoot complex technical issues.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to communicate eff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ders. Leadership skills and the ability to mentor and guide junior developers. Proven track record of delivering high-quality solutions on time and within scope. Requirement of going in office 3x a week.
